7590-01-P NUCLEAR REGULATORY COMMISSION SOUTHERN CALIFORNIA EDISON COMPANY DOCKET NOS. 50-361 AND 50-362 NOTICE OF WITHDRAWAL OF APPLICATION FOR AMENDMENTS TO FACILITY OPERATING LICENSES
[NRC-2011-0029]
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(the Commission or NRC) has granted the request of Southern California Edison (SCE, the licensee) to withdraw its January 14, 2010, application for proposed amendments to Facility Operating License Nos. NPF-10 and NPF-15 for the San Onofre Nuclear Generating Station (SONGS), Units 2 and 3, respectively, located in San Diego County, California.
The proposed amendments would have revised a number of Technical Specification (TS) requirements, to impose similar restrictions on the movement of non-irradiated fuel assemblies to those currently in place for movement of irradiated fuel assemblies. The additional restrictions would limit the movement of all fuel assemblies over irradiated fuel assemblies in containment or in the fuel storage pool.
The Commission had previously issued a Notice of Consideration of Issuance of Amendment published in the FEDERAL REGISTER on May 18, 2010 (75 FR 27832). However, by letter dated January 27, 2011, the licensee withdrew the proposed changes.
For further details with respect to this action, see the application for amendment dated January 14, 2010, and the licensee's letter dated January 27, 2011, which withdrew the application for license amendment.
